Beginnings and Structure

Helen Schucman, a clinical psycho therapist at Columbia University, claimed that the content of a Course in Miracles was formed to her by a voice she known as Jesus. The course acim was written over a period of seven years and consists of three main sections: the text, the Workbook for Students, and the Manual for Teachers.

The text supplies the theoretical framework of the course, explaining its core principles, such as the nature of reality, the illusion of the ego, and the significance about forgiveness.
The Workbook for Students contains 365 lessons, each designed to help the student apply the teachings of the course in their daily life. The lessons guide students toward experiencing work day in perception, enabling them to let go of fear, judgment, and negativity.
The Manual for Teachers addresses the role of those who wish to teach the principles of the course, providing answers to common questions about the course's practical application.
The course's primary focus is on what to shift one's perception from fear to love, which is viewed as the fact of healing and spiritual enlightenment.

Key Concepts and Teachings

The Illusion of Separating
At the core of a Course in Miracles is the idea that our perception of separating from others, from God, and from the world is an illusion. According to the course, the ego—the false self we create through judgment, fear, and attachment—is the cause of this illusion. The ego promotes thoughts of scarcity, competition, and conflict, making us believe that we are separate and separated beings. The truth, as described in ACIM, is that we are all perhaps the same divine source, connected through love and unity.

The course teaches that the physical world, with its seeming conflicts, suffering, and divisions, is not real in the endless sense. Instead, it is a dream-like projection of our own egos. True reality, according to ACIM, is spiritual, endless, and operating out of love. Waking up from this illusion involves recognizing the oneness of all beings and seeing beyond the ego's projections.

Forgiveness as the Key to Healing
One of the most powerful and central teachings of a Course in Miracles is the concept of forgiveness. However, the forgiveness promoted by the course is not the typical form of forgiving others for their wrongdoings. ACIM suggests that the traditional concept of forgiveness, where we forgive someone because they have "done something wrong, " is rooted in the ego and judgment. Instead, ACIM presents a higher form of forgiveness: the release of our own judgments and the recognition that no one has truly harmed us, because all actions are the result of the ego’s illusions.

Forgiveness in this context is about seeing beyond the errors of the world and recognizing the inherent innocence of others. By forgiving, we let go of resentment and guilt, which are the chains that keep us trapped in suffering. The course focuses on that true forgiveness heals both the person who forgives and the one who is forgiven, as it restores peace and love to both.

Miracles as a Shift in Perception
Miracles, as described in a Course in Miracles, are not supernatural events, but work day in perception that allow us to see the world through the lens of love rather than fear. A miracle occurs when we let go of our ego-based thoughts and judgments, opening ourselves to a higher understanding of the truth.

According to the course, every act of forgiveness is a miracle, as it mirrors a difference in how you perceive others and ourselves. When we release the ego’s grip, we are able to see others as they truly are—extensions of love and divine light. This shift in perception allows us to experience peace, joy, and a deep sense of experience of the world around us.

The Role of the Holy Spirit
In a Course in Miracles, the Holy Spirit is seen as a divine presence within us, guiding us back to the truth. The Holy Spirit is often described as the voice for God within the individual, offering us gentle ticklers to choose love over fear. The Holy Spirit offers a different way of perceiving the world, helping us to reinterpret situations and relationships in a way that leads to healing.

ACIM teaches that the Holy Spirit’s guidance is always available to us, but we must be ready to listen and be open to the voice of love. Through our motivation to give up our egos and accept the Holy Spirit’s guidance, we align with the divine will and experience greater peace and fulfillment.

The nature of Reality
The course teaches that the material world is an illusion—a temporary symptoms that mirrors our taken wrongly thoughts about ourselves and the world. The only true the reality is spiritual, endless, and unchanging. This concept aligns with many forms of mystical and non-dualistic spiritual traditions, which are saying that the physical world is not the ultimate reality.

In this view, the body, time, and space are seen as symbols of the ego’s belief in separating. Our identification with the body, the past, and the future causes us to experience suffering. True healing comes when we release these attachments and remember our true nature as spiritual beings, powering God and together.
